Hushpuppi's ally, Woodberry to Face 14 Years Jail Term Over $8Million Scam.



The ally of the notorious scammer, Hushpuppi, Woodberry is said to face a 14-year jail term over an $8 million scam.

According to reports, the US Federal prosecutors on Thursday told the judge to sentence internet fraudster, Woodberry to 14 years in jail for defrauding multiple US companies.

Hushpuppi and his friend, Woodberry pleaded guilty to count one of the eight counts brought against him in the US court. After he pleaded guilty, Woodberry agreed to surrender $8 million in proceeds of wire fraud as well as luxury cars and watches to the foreign government.

"The government recommends that this court sentence the defendant to 168 months' imprisonment, which is sufficient, but not greater than necessary, to comply with the purposes set forth in 18 U.S.C. § 3553(a)," the prosecutors said.


"The government further recommends that the court order restitution and forfeiture as described above and impose a special assessment of $100."
